Turkey's blind footballers congratulated on Euro win

ANKARA

The head of sports for the visually impaired in Turkey on Monday congratulated the country’s blind football team on becoming European champions.

Abdullah Cetin, president of the Turkish Blind Sports Federation, told Anadolu Agency the squad’s success was even more notable because it was achieved with inexperienced players.

“We entered the championship with young players,” he said. “We played a final for the first time and won the title.”

By reaching the final in Hereford, U.K., the Turkish squad qualified for the Paralympic Games in Rio de Janeiro next year.

“Our goal was to play in the final,” Cetin said. “In addition, we wanted to be in Rio. We did it. We had a comfortable win against Russia.”

Turkey was among 10 teams competing in the European Championship that began on Aug. 22.

The team progressed to the final on Saturday by beating Poland and Italy in their group and drawing against Germany. They came second in the group after they lost to England, facing Spain in the semi-final, which they won 2-0.

The Turkish side secured the trophy with a 1-0 victory over Russia.

Blind football is played between five-a-side teams over two halves of 25 minutes. Players, who are either totally blind or who wear blacked-out goggles if they are partially sighted, can be guided by instructions shouted from off-pitch. The ball is fitted with internal bells to allow the players to judge its position by sound.

Omer Gursoy, chairman of the Turkish Football Federation’s handicapped coordination committee, added: “Before the joining the championship we said that we would be in the final because our youth system is the strongest one.

“Winning the European title is not a big surprise for us. It's not a coincidence. We reap the harvest of the system that we established.”

The victorious squad will attend Turkey’s Euro 2016 qualifier against the Netherlands in Konya on Sept. 6.
